What affects the price

Replacing a water heater involves several variables that change the final bill. The main factors are the type of unit you choose—like standard tank models versus tankless systems—and the fuel source, whether gas or electric. Installation complexity also plays a role, especially if we need to update venting, gas lines, or electrical wiring to meet current building codes. Relocating a unit or upgrading to a higher capacity will also shift the bottom line.

How long do hot water heaters typically last?

In a place like Urban Honolulu, tanked water heaters generally last between 8 to 12 years. Tankless models, with proper maintenance, can often exceed 20 years. Factors like water quality and usage patterns in your Honolulu home can influence this lifespan, so it's good to have it assessed.

What is the most efficient type of water heater?

For efficiency in a Hawaiian climate, tankless water heaters are often the most efficient choice. They heat water on demand, reducing standby energy losses common with traditional tank models. This can be a great benefit for energy-conscious households in Honolulu.

What are signs I need a new water heater?

Common signs you need a new water heater include inconsistent water temperature, unusual noises like rumbling or popping, and visible rust or leaks. If your water heater is nearing the end of its typical lifespan in Honolulu, it's wise to start looking for replacements proactively.

What is the most common problem with a hot water heater?

A very common issue is sediment buildup inside the tank, which can reduce efficiency and cause noise. Another frequent problem involves thermostat malfunctions or heating element failures. These are issues a licensed pro can diagnose and address.

Is it worth it to repair a hot water heater?

Whether it's worth it to repair a hot water heater depends on the age of the unit and the nature of the problem. Minor repairs on a relatively new unit might be cost-effective. However, if your water heater in Urban Honolulu is old or facing major issues, replacement is often the better long-term investment.
